What Is Personal Injury?
Personal injury is the legal term for harm or damage to someone’s mind or body, due to someone else’s negligence, recklessness, or intentional actions. Personal injury cases allow people who have suffered harm or losses to get compensation for someone else’s wrongful conduct. Compensation typically is awarded for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, emotional distress, and other losses. Common types of personal injury cases include:
- Car, train, and boat accidents
- Slip-and-fall and trip-and-fall accidents
- Defective products that cause harm
- Medical malpractice
- Animal attacks
- Invasion of privacy and trespassing
- Infliction of emotional distress
- Assault and battery
- Spinal cord and sports injuries
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Personal Injury Lawyer?
You might need a personal injury lawyer if you’re:
- Injured in a car accident caused by another driver
- Slip and fall on someone’s property due to unsafe conditions
- Defamed by something someone said about you
- A victim of medical errors
- Attacked by someone else’s dog
- Hurt by a defective product
- Assaulted by someone without provoking them
You will also want to speak to a personal injury lawyer if a member of your family was killed by someone else’s negligence. This is called a wrongful death lawsuit.

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Personal Injury Lawyer?
If you don’t hire a personal injury lawyer, you might struggle to get fair compensation for your injuries. Without legal guidance, you could miss important deadlines to file a lawsuit, fail to gather the right evidence, or be taken advantage of by insurance companies. This might result in accepting a settlement offer that is less than what you need to cover medical bills, lost wages, and other expenses. A lawyer helps protect your rights, builds a strong case, and negotiates on your behalf, increasing your chances of getting the most possible compensation.
